Airbus Defence and Space is a division of Airbus Group formed by combining the business activities of Cassidian, Astrium and Airbus Military. The new division is Europes number one defence and space enterprise, the second largest space business worldwide and among the top ten global defence enterprises. It employs some 40,000 employees generating revenues of approximately 14 billion per year. A vacancy for a Composites Engineer Materials Processes has arisen within Airbus Defence Space in Stevenage. You will provide materials, mechanical parts and processes engineering support to product development and to business unit projects as required. You will also contribute to the Materials and Processes team mission of assuring the quality of materials and processes used in Airbus Defence and Space products. The successful candidate will be subject to UK National Security Clearance in order to undertake related work in accordance with business needs. Your main tasks and responsibilities will include Acting as the responsible materials engineer for one or more projectproduct teams, as necessary acting as the single contact point for the resolution of all materials and processes issues. To satisfy internal customers projects, product teams, manufacturing, AIT, procurement, design office, PA. through the application of specialist materials and processes knowledge. To assure performance of planned activities, on time and with respect to the governing product assurance requirements. To instigate and manage to completion materials and processes selection, development, evaluation and qualification programmes. To participate in risk reviews at all stages of product design, development and manufacture, ensuring that materials and processes risk retirement plans are carried through. To prepare declared materials and processes lists and ensure that adequate materials and processes qualification has been achieved by CDR. To review and approve subcontractorsupplier materials and processes documentation. To monitor the technical performance of subcontractors and suppliers and participate in audits. We are looking for candidates with the following skills and experience Degree in a Chemistry or Materials discipline with experience within the Space or Aerospace industry. Proven experience in Composites and Nonmetallic Materials. Good understanding of Thermoset and Thermoplastic polymer materials. Experience of Mechanical and Thermal testing of materials. Experience of variety of Carbon fibre reinforcements and other fibres such as Kevlar, glass, would be desirable. Knowledge of Lightweight structures in extreme environments. Knowledge of processing Composites Prepregs, filament winding, RTM. Knowledge of secondary operations adhesive bonding, insert potting. Surface analytical techniques SEM, EDAX, XPS, etc. Characterisation of materials DSC, DMA, TMA, etc. Chemical analysis FTIR, MSGC, ICP.
